Intelligentsia: What they call “OCU” cannot be called Ukrainian Church
Participants of the forum in support of the UOC KP. Photo: Kiev Patriarchate website
Representatives of the Ukrainian intelligentsia who took part in the forum "For the Ukrainian Orthodox Church!" For the Kiev Patriarchate! For Ukraine!” reminded the public that it’s impossible to even call the OCU Ukrainian Church. The text of their appeal “to the believing Ukrainian people” was published on the official website of the UOC KP.
The document also underlined that not only the "pro-Moscow ‘fifth column’" acts against the UOC KP, but also "our own ‘fellow countrymen’ – short-sighted public and political figures of even national-patriotic and democratic movement."
“Today, because of the power manipulations in the church life and the latest atheistic experiments on the UOC of the Kiev Patriarchate, the autocephalous movement in Ukraine has been virtually destroyed. The newly-established church called Orthodox Church in Ukraine is even deprived of the right to be called the UKRAINIAN Church! We are forced to close the church gates to the Ukrainians of the Diaspora and abandon our sacred heritage of Rus-Ukraine!” noted the drafters of the appeal.
They also added that the "atrocities in the Ukrainian church life" could not be eliminated, although former President of Ukraine Petro Poroshenko “was shown ‘political doors’ by 73% of voters". However, the Ukrainian intelligentsia is not angry with the destroyers of autocephaly.
“Watching the 'wicked great-grandchildren' (Taras Shevchenko) mocking at the Ukrainian Church and the Kiev Patriarchate, we can only recall the words of Christ:“ Father, forgive them because they don’t know what they are doing! ” (Luke 23: 34),” said its representatives in the text of their appeal.
According to the forum participants, the media has launched a whole campaign against the head of the UOC KP, Filaret Denisenko, “who is perhaps the only one who has raised his voice in defense of the Native Church and the Kiev Patriarchate.”
Representatives of the intelligentsia are outraged that “in spite of all church canons” in Ukraine they must recognize the right of the church court of Phanar and the need to buy Holy Myrrh from the Constantinople Patriarchate.
“Let alone the foreign Statute for the OCU imposed on us, the right to open foreign Stavropegia (!!!) on the Ukrainian canonical territory. It is not by chance that the Ukrainians already compare the autocephaly of the hyped ‘Tomos’ with the false status of the Ukrainian SSR as an ‘independent state’,” reads the text of the appeal to the Ukrainians.
The UOC KP itself is named in the document as the “spiritual basis of the Ukrainian Statehood and a talisman against the new spiritual enslavement of the Ukrainians".
“Let's unite around the Holy Ukrainian Orthodox Church of the Kiev Patriarchate! Let us remember that only the Kiev Patriarchate can be the embodiment of the eternal dream of our ancestors, as well as present and future generations, to secure for Ukrainians ‘who live in Ukraine and outside Ukraine’ (Taras Shevchenko) a real UKRAINIAN CHURCH!" urged the forum participants “For the Kiev Patriarchate! For Ukraine!”
Earlier, “Patriarch of Kiev and All Rus-Ukraine” Filaret said that the UOC KP had been allegedly created according to God's will. “I am sure that the Kiev Patriarchate was created by the will of God. And if it is the will of God, no force will destroy the Kiev Patriarchate, because God stands behind it,” he stressed.
